Learning Goals and Outcomes

The following are the Learning Goals and Outcomes defined for the four programs offered by the Faculty of Business Administration at Lakehead University.

Honours Bachelor of Commerce

Learning Goal (graduates to “be” or “have”)Learning Objective (graduate to “do” or “make)
1) Graduates should be effective communicators.1.1) Graduates will communicate orally in an effective manner.
1.2) Our graduates will prepare professional written reports.
2) Graduates should be critical thinkers when making business decisions.2.1) Graduates will understand the foundational knowledge of all business areas.
2.2) Graduates will have specialized knowledge of their selected major.
2.3) Graduates will think critically when integrating knowledge of business concepts when solving real-life business problems.
3) Graduates should have the skills to become effective business leaders.3.1) Graduates will apply ethical resolution techniques to ethical dilemmas.
3.2) Graduates will demonstrate knowledge of effective leadership practices.
3.3) Graduates will work effectively in teams.
4) Graduates should be able to function in a global business environment.4.1) Graduates will understand the importance of a global context when making business decisions.
4.2) Graduates will appreciate Aboriginal world views as they relate to the business environment.

Masters of Business Administration (MBA)

Learning Goal (graduates to “be” or “have”)Learning Objective (graduate to “do” or “make)
1) Our graduates should have a comprehensive and integrated knowledge of management functions1.1) Our graduates will understand technical business skills and apply them in new and unfamiliar circumstances.
1.2) Our graduates will integrate all the management function areas into a coherent strategic whole.
2) Our graduates should be analytical decision-makers.2.1) Our graduates will think analytically to identify a problem and apply appropriate quantitative and qualitative analysis to develop workable solutions.
3) Our graduates should be effective communicators.3.1) Our graduates will deliver clear and persuasive oral presentations to business audiences.
3.2) Our graduates will prepare clear and persuasive written reports to business audiences.
4) Our graduates should demonstrate the techniques to become effective business leaders.4.1) Our graduates will apply ethical resolution techniques to ethical dilemmas to provide recommended course of action.
4.2) Our graduates will work well in teams.
4.3) Our graduates will understand leadership theories.
4.4) Our graduates will understand how globalization and the global environment impact individuals, businesses, and the economy.

Masters of Science of Management (MSc.)

Learning Goal (graduates to “be” or “have”)Learning Objective (graduate to “do” or “make)
1) Our graduates should have advanced knowledge of theoretical and conceptual components of the management disciplines.1.1) Our graduates will apply advanced level knowledge in the use of key management tools when making business decisions.
2) Our graduates should be able to independently undertake original research within the domain of management disciplines.2.1) Our graduates will formulate a research question, understand quantitative and qualitative methodologies, select the appropriate methodology for a given research question, comprehend limitations, and understand the implications of the analysis.
2.2) Our graduates will understand ethical considerations when conducting management research.
3) Our graduates should be able to disseminate research findings in business contexts3.1) Our graduates will orally communicate academic work clearly and persuasively to business and academic audiences.
3.2) Our graduates will clearly and persuasively communicate academic work in a written report to business and academic audiences.
4) Our graduates should be able to apply research findings in business contexts4.1) Our graduates will demonstrate an understanding of how academic research impacts the business practice.
4.2) Our graduates will perform effectively in a research-oriented position in their profession.
